How can I make my room a little more soundproof?


You can definitely use rugs to minimize sound, and you will notice the difference especially if you currently have flooring and no carpet.

To maximize the sound proofing, use plush rugs such as a super soft shag or flokati. A rug such as this Chocolate Flokati is super thick, and if you cover your flooring with it can minimize any sound coming from your room.

In addition to the area rugs, you can add weather stripping to the inside of your door frame. Most people don't weather strip inside, but it is a great way to minimize sound coming in and out.

Curtains on your window also help diminish sound from inside and out. Buy a thick cotton curtain as opposed to sheers.

Can I add rhinestones to my walls?

dyn-300-myst-0020-8168-01.jpgIt sounds like you want a pretty room, and you can definitely put rhinestones on the walls. I've done it myself.  Here is what I did to add rhinestones.

Get a stencil that you like.  In a room like yours, you can add a stencil that represents something you like about gypsy/renaissance.  Big flowers, leaves, etc are all great for a theme like that. I did large leaves in the room I stenciled, and started them down by the floor and took them halfway up the wall. When I was done, it looked like large plants growing from the floor.  Take the rhinestones and a hot glue gun (get your mom to help if need be). Glue them in strategic places within your stencil. I did a trail around and through certain leaves.  It looks really pretty.

If you have really big rhinestones (mine were small), you could put fake frames around them and glue them to your wall.  Add a small water fountain in one corner. It is soothing and would work in your theme.

For curtains, use long, colorful scarves. Clip them to the rod with curtain clips, and alternate colors.

Help on redecorating my room?

I want to paint the walls a new color, probably a dark red

dyn-allure1904-300.jpgI've had a bright red room and it becomes a little harsh to sleep in. Dark red is beautiful, and really eye catching, but you become tired of it quickly. If possible stay far, far away from tomato reds and find a wine color or a rich, deep, warm red that you really like. If you worry about painting the entire room red, do a feature wall with the red color and the other colors a contrast.
